Scandium Canada Ltd V.SCD

Alternate Symbol(s):  SCDCF

Scandium Canada Ltd., formerly Imperial Mining Group Ltd., is a Canadian technology metals company focused on advancing its flagship Crater Lake scandium and rare earth projects in Quebec. It specializes in mining exploration for gold, base metal and technology metal mining sites located in Canada. It is focused on the advancement of its Crater Lake Scandium-REE project in Northeastern Quebec. It also holds gold properties in the Abitibi greenstone belt. Its Crater Lake Project is located about 200 kilometers (km) northeast of Schefferville, Quebec. The property consists of about 96 contiguous claims covering 47 square kilometers. Its Opawica Project is located about 20 km East of Desmaraisville and is accessible via Highway 113 going from Val-d’Or to Chibougamau, Quebec. The property consists of about 42 contiguous claims covering 23.45 square kilometers. Its La Ronciere Project is located about 35 km East of Desmaraisville. The property consists of about 45 contiguous claims.

A metal of the future focused in Québec

A metal of the future focused in QuébecScandium Canada: A metal of the future focused in Qubec.

According to Modor Intelligence, in 2023 the global scandium market size was US$593.80 million, which is projected to grow to US$1.344 billion in 2029. Alloys accounted for the largest share (35%) in the product type segment in the global scandium market in 2023 due to its high usage in the major end-use industries and its excellent strength. There is growing demand for aluminium scandium alloys in the aerospace and defence industries. The Boeing Commercial Outlook 2023-2042 reports that in China about 8,560 new deliveries will be made by 2042, followed by 9,250 deliveries in North America, 3,025 in the Middle East, and 1,205 across Africa. Boeing expects 42,595 global deliveries by 2042, providing an opportunity for increasing demand for aluminium scandium alloys for aircraft manufacturing in the upcoming years. Further, in 2023 AIRBUS delivered 735 aircraft, with an order backlog of 8,598 units. The US aerospace sector is one of the largest worldwide in terms of infrastructure and manufacturing activities. In the past half-decade, some 1,000 helicopters have been delivered in the US, as per Modor Intelligence.
